Porto vs Warsaw — Budget Breakdown
Numbeo 2026 country rankings (cost indices) and OECD 2025 PPP rates · April 2026
Feasibility
Porto
Moderate
COL+Rent: 29.8 (NYC=100)
$1,500/mo covers essentials with some leisure in Porto.
Warsaw
Tight Budget
COL+Rent: 40.3 (NYC=100)
$1,500/mo barely covers basics in Warsaw.
Budget Breakdown
| Category | Porto | Warsaw | Diff |
|---|---|---|---|
| Rent (avg 1BR) | $806 | $785 | +$21 |
| Groceries | $253 | $233 | +$20 |
| Dining Out | $161 | $168 | $7 |
| Transportation | $40 | $30 | +$10 |
| Utilities | $118 | $166 | $48 |
| Other / Misc | $122 | $118 | +$4 |
| Total | $1,500 | $1,500 | — |
Purchasing Power
Porto
$1,500
per month
Warsaw equivalent
$2,029
per month
You'd need $2,029/mo in Warsaw to match $1,500/mo in Porto.
